Frankfort, Kentucky
Newly renovated 1 bedroom, 2 story loft in the Historic St. Claire Entertainment District of Frankfort Kentucky. Enjoy the best Kentucky has to offer with easy access to famous distilleries such as Buffalo Trace and Woodford Reserve and enjoy live thoroughbred racing at Keeneland Racetrack in nearby Lexington, KY.
The space
2 story, 900 square foot apartment. The apartment is located on the second floor of the building. There is no elevator so you must be able to use stairs. Full kitchen, with a cozy living room and dining area and half-bath are downstairs. Upstairs opens up to a large bedroom with a laundry room off the closet and a full bath. Both the living room and bedroom are furnished with smart TV's and free wifi throughout the unit.
Guest access
Guests will be given the code to the building's exterior doors and a personalized code for entrance to the loft door during their stay. There are approximately 25 stair steps to reach the 2nd floor where the unit is located. Security cameras are located at the exterior entrances for guest safety.
Other things to note
Rules are simple. No pets, no parties and no smoking inside the building.
